Crossword-Solution: ACHLAMYDEOUS
Dictionary
| Word | Word Type | Definition |
|---|---|---|
| Achlamydeous | a. | Naked; having no floral envelope, neither calyx nor corolla. |

Sentences with ACHLAMYDEOUS (2)
Incomplete flowers, accordingly, are _Naked_ or _Achlamydeous_, destitute of both floral envelopes, as in Fig.
ACHLAMYDEOUS (ak-la-mid'i-us), in botany, wanting the floral envelopes, that is, having neither calyx nor corolla, as the willow.
